In the private equity world, partnership agreements have received praise from many corners for reducing the agency costs arising between the interests of fund managers and investors. This article sets out to assess contract design in private equity partnerships. The argument here is that the importance of many of these heralded contract design features has been overstated. Part II describes the legal rights of investors in private equity funds. By default, investors in private limited partnerships have limited rights to participate in day-to-day operations or challenge decisions of fund managers. As a result of this set of default legal rules, investors in these funds face a familiar agency problem. That is, fund managers may be emboldened to pursue their own self-interest at the expens...

The Commodity Futures Trading Commission (Commission) is adopting final regulations to implement certain provisions of Title VII and Title VIII of the Dodd-Frank Wall Street Reform and Consumer Protection Act (Dodd-Frank Act) governing derivatives clearing organization (DCO) activities. More specifically, the regulations establish the regulatory standards for compliance with DCO Core Principles A (Compliance), B (Financial Resources), C (Participant and Product Eligibility), D (Risk Management), E (Settlement Procedures), F (Treatment of Funds), G (Default Rules and Procedures), H (Rule Enforcement), I (System Safeguards), J (Reporting), K (Recordkeeping), L (Public Information), M (Information Sharing), N (Antitrust Considerations), and R (Legal Risk) set forth in Section 5b of the Com...
